Marshmallow Cheesecake Ingredients
Let s gather everything you need for this fluffy delight!
For the Filling
- Cream cheese 8 oz (226 g) Ensure it’s softened for a smooth blend.
- Powdered sugar 1 cup (120 g) This sweetener dissolves easily and adds a creamy texture.
- Vanilla extract 1 tsp A splash of vanilla enhances the overall flavor beautifully.
- Marshmallow cream 1 container (7 oz or 198 g) This adds the signature sweetness and lightness to your cheesecake.
- Whipped topping 1 container (8 oz or 226 g) Folding this in creates a wonderfully airy texture.
For the Crust
- Pre-made graham cracker crust 1 (9-inch) Saves time and offers a classic flavor that pairs perfectly with the cheesecake filling.
For the Optional Toppings
- White frosting 1/2 cup (60 g) Use for an extra sweet finishing touch if desired.
- Marshmallows or sprinkles For garnish Add these right before serving to elevate your presentation.

How to Make Marshmallow Cheesecake
Beat the Cream Cheese: In a large bowl, use an electric mixer to beat the softened cream cheese until it s smooth and creamy. This will be the delectable base of your cheesecake!
Add Sugar and Vanilla: Sprinkle in the powdered sugar and add the vanilla extract. Beat again until everything is well incorporated and those flavors meld beautifully together!
Fold in Marshmallow Cream: Gently fold in the marshmallow cream. Be cautious not to overmix; the goal is to maintain an airy texture for that dreamy quality.
Incorporate Whipped Topping: Next, delicately fold in the whipped topping until it’s evenly distributed throughout the mixture. This step adds that light, whipped sensation.
Pour into Crust: Pour the luscious mixture into the pre-made graham cracker crust. Use a spatula to even out the top, creating a smooth and inviting surface.
Optional Frosting Layer: If you re feeling indulgent, spread a thin layer of white frosting over the top for an extra touch of sweetness and visual appeal.
Chill the Cheesecake: Place the cheesecake in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ight. This chilling time allows the flavors to awaken and the texture to firm up nicely!
Garnish Before Serving: Just before you re ready to serve, add some mini marshmallows or colorful sprinkles on top for a fun and festive touch!
Optional: Add a drizzle of chocolate sauce for an extra indulgent treat.

Expert Tips for Marshmallow Cheesecake
Soften Cream Cheese: Take your cream cheese out at least 30 minutes before using to ensure it blends smoothly, creating that signature creamy texture.
Folding Technique: Always fold gently when incorporating the marshmallow cream and whipped topping. Overmixing can lead to a dense cheesecake instead of the light, airy texture we love!
Chill Time Matters: For the best results, let your cheesecake chill overnight.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ully and the texture to firm up perfectly.
Customize Toppings: Feel free to mix and match toppings! Try adding fresh fruit or a drizzle of chocolate to elevate your Marshmallow Cheesecake experience.
Using Crust Wisely: If you want a bit more crunch in your crust, consider briefly toasting the graham cracker crust in the oven before filling it. Just a few minutes will enhance its flavor!
Make Ahead Options
These Marshmallow Cheesecake bites are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time! You can prepare the cheesecake filling up to 24 hours in advance; simply make the mixture as directed and pour it into the graham cracker crust, then cover tightly with plastic wrap to prevent air from getting in. For even better flavor, chill it overnight in the refrigerator. When you’re ready to serve, add your optional toppings, such as white frosting and mini marshmallows or sprinkles, right before serving to keep them fresh and delightful. Marshmallow Cheesecake Variations
Get ready to elevate your dessert game with exciting twists that will suit every palate!
- Nutty Delight: Add 1/2 cup finely chopped nuts to the cheesecake mixture for a crunchy texture and nutty flavor boost.
- Chocolate Indulgence: Swirl in 1/4 cup melted chocolate into the cheesecake filling for a rich, decadent variation that chocolate lovers will adore.
- Berry Bliss: Fold in 1 cup of fresh berries, like strawberries or blueberries, for a delightful burst of fruity freshness throughout every bite.
- Zesty Citrus: Incorporate the zest of one lemon or orange into the filling for a refreshing citrus twist that brightens the flavor profile.
- Gluten-Free Option: Use a gluten-free graham cracker crust to make this treat suitable for those avoiding gluten, while still enjoying that classic taste.
- Vegan Version: Swap the cream cheese for a dairy-free cream cheese alternative and use coconut whipped cream instead of regular whipped topping for a creamy vegan twist.
- Spicy Kick: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of cinnamon to the filling for a surprising and delightful hint of warmth amid the sweetness.
- Marshmallow Swirl: Reserve a little marshmallow cream and swirl it on top of the cheesecake before chilling for an extra layer of marshmallow goodness.
How to Store and Freeze Marshmallow Cheesecake
Fridge: Store any leftover Marshmallow Cheesecake in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. This ensures it stays fresh and creamy!
Freezer: If you want to keep your cheesecake for longer, freeze individual slices wrapped t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il for up to 2 months.
Thawing: To enjoy frozen cheesecake, transfer it to the fridge overnight to thaw. This allows it to regain its delightful texture without compromising flavor.
Reheating: There s no need to reheat this cheesecake. Just let it chill in the fridge, then enjoy the cool, creamy indulgence straight from the fridge!

What should I do if my cheesecake texture is dense?
Ah, if your cheesecake turns out dense, it could be because you overmixed the filling at one stage or didn’t allow enough chilling time. Make sure to fold in your whipped topping and marshmallow cream gently to maintain that airy quality! Always allow for adequate chilling as well overnight is best for achieving that perfect texture.
